PREET HARPAL TO RECORD A DUET SONG WITH MAHARASHTRA CHIEF MINISTER'S WIFE, AMRUTA FADNAVIS

By  Parkash Deep Singh December 4th 2017 08:46 AM

Punjabi star singer Preet harpal will soon be singing a duet song with Amruta Fadnavis who happens to be the wife of Maharashtra’s Chief Minister Devendra Fadnavis. Revealing the news on his social media account, Preet Harpal shared his picture with Amruta Fadnavis and said that his next track is on the way.

Famous Bollywood choreographer Ahmed Khan will also collaborate with Preet Harpal in this mixtape. Preet harpal has added to his fans’ curiosity by also tagging star singer Deep Mani.

This is to be noted that Amruta Devendra Fadnavis is a trained classical singer, a social activist, and a banker. She is married to 18th Chief Minister of Maharashtra, Devendra Fadnavis and is the youngest first lady in the history of Maharashtra. Amruta Fadnavis' first music video "Phir Se" featuring Amitabh Bachchan released by T-Series was viewed over 7 lakh times in a single day and reached over 1.4 million views in 3 days.
